Ask Minnesota Lawmakers to Support Coverage for Obesity Care

Background: For years advocates have worked to improve access to care for Minnesotans living with obesity. The Minnesota General Assembly has introduced legislation which would provide coverage for the comprehensive treatment of obesity to allow patients and their healthcare providers additional tools in their individual journey to improved health.

HF 690/SF 2075 would provide coverage for the comprehensive treatment of obesity under state-regulated health plans and Minnesota’s Medical Assistance Program – including coverage for intensive behavioral therapy, bariatric surgery, and FDA-approved anti-obesity medications.
